- East Hill Singers Seize the Day — by cherylca — last modified Jul 07, 2015 02:13 PM
- The East Hill Singers, a chorus comprised of inmates from Lansing Correctional Facility and volunteer singers from the Kansas City area, took to the road for their annual tour of performances in and around Kansas City. The group performs several times a year as an effort to incorporate the arts in the rehabilitation process. The Seize the Day collection of songs performed this year includes the crowd-favorite "The Lion Sleeps Tonight," which can be viewed here.

- Second Escapee from Winfield Correctional Facility Captured — by cherylca — last modified Mar 12, 2015 02:00 PM
- Authorities located Robert E. Cook, 52, Monday morning in Byers, more than a week after Cook and another inmate fled Winfield Correctional Facility in a state-owned truck. The other inmate, Frank Crutchfield, 48, was arrested Wednesday, June 20.
- One Winfield Correctional Facility Escapee Back in Custody — by cherylca — last modified Mar 12, 2015 02:00 PM
- A Crime Stoppers tip led to the arrest Wednesday of escapee Frank L. Crutchfield, 48, by Wichita Police. Authorities continue to search for Robert E. Cook, 52, who escaped with Crutchield from Winfield Correctional Facility Saturday.
